Display keys on handset:
Pressing a key launches the function that
appears above that key in the display.
Display
icon
Function when pressed
INT
Call other registered handsets
¢ page 9.
MENU
Open main/submenu (see
Menu tree
¢ page 13).
“
Go back one menu level.
U
Scroll up/down or adjust
volume with u.
T
Move cursor to left/right
with u.
˜
Backspace deletes one charac-
ter at a time from right to left.
OK
Confirm menu function or
save entry.
